Ultra-small modulator and demodulator for 10 Gb/s differential phase-shift-keying (DPSK), using silicon-based microrings, are proposed. A single-waveguide microring modulator with over-coupling between ring and waveguide generates a DPSK signal, while a double-waveguide microring filter enables balanced DPSK detection. In this paper an unconventional, simple BPSK demodulator is proposed. Complexity of the conventional BPSK demodulator is reduced by utilizing a l-bit Analog-to-Digital (A/D) converter front-end. The optimal detection rule is derived for BPSK signals going through the l-bit A/D front-end. I/Q demodulation is a common and useful RF signal processing technique used in charged-particle accelerators. When implemented with conventional analog RF components, a number of inherent errors can degrade the I/Q Demodulator performance, including gain balance, quadrature-phase balance, DC offsets, impedance match, and carrier leakage. A Silicon-on-Insulator (SOI) Differential Quadrature Phase Shift Keying (DQPSK) demodulator based on a novel Multimode Interference (MMI) design is characterized for a number of operating wavelengths, with results indicating good uniformity and low wavelength dependency. A baseband digital narrow-band FM receiver, called zero-intermediate frequency zero-crossing demodulator (ZIFZCD), has been recently developed. This demodulator may offer low complexity and simple implementation.
